TYL Introduces Route CePA: A New Service to Enhance Animal Hospital Operations
In a significant move for the animal healthcare sector, TYL Co., Ltd. has officially launched Route CePA, a new service integrated into its comprehensive media platform, PCEPA. This service aims to assist veterinarians and animal hospital directors by providing accessible information and resources to address operational challenges.
Expanding Resources for Animal Hospitals
With the mission of promoting pet family integration, TYL's PCEPA (accessible at
pet-pace.com) has been a valuable resource for animal hospitals, offering seminars and articles covering a wide range of topics, from patient acquisition to hiring and business management. The platform not only hosts both online and offline seminars but also provides insightful articles addressing various operational intricacies faced by veterinarians in managing their practices.
By launching Route CePA, PCEPA now features an additional resource platform where users can request information about services offered by partner companies. This initiative is designed to address multiple managerial challenges such as recruitment, IT systems, and operational efficiency in animal hospitals. The best part? PCEPA members can access these resources for free, enabling them to find tailored solutions that match their specific needs.

The Vision of TYL
Founded with the goal of promoting family-like bonds between pets and their owners, TYL is a rapidly growing venture that operates with a dual focus on business support for animal hospitals and assistance for pet owners. Utilizing advanced technology, TYL strives to create valuable systems that enhance pets’ health and well-being while fostering a society where pets and owners can live happily together.
